Abstract

Hoja no tejida formada hidráulicamente que comprende fibras poliméricas no celulósicas de diámetro << 3,5 micras y longitud de corte menor a 3 mm y fibras poliméricas no celulósicas de diámetro > 3,5 micras, donde la hoja tiene un peso básico de 15 a 250 g/m2; empaque de artículo; método de empaque; y método de manufactura de hoja.
